Web26 okt. 2024 · Lithified volcanic ash is known as tuff. This comes in two varieties. Welded tuff has its origins when the beds of volcanic ash, when they form, are hot enough for the clasts to compact and weld together. Andrew Alden. Updated on September 28, 2024. Lithification is how soft sediments, the end product of erosion, become rigid rock ("lithi-" means rock in scientific Greek). It begins when sediment, like sand, mud, silt and clay, is laid down for the last time and becomes gradually buried and compressed under new sediment.

Webground-hugging mixture of ash, pumice, rock fragments, and hot gas that rushes down the side of a volcano at speeds of 100 km/hour or more. The temperature within pyroclastic flows can reach 500° C or more. Tuffs on Earth are volcano-sedimentary deposits that become consolidated either by welding from residual heat or through compaction and cementation from pore fluids.

Pyroclasts of different sizes are classified (from smallest to largest) as volcanic ash, lapilli, or volcanic blocks (or, if they exhibit evidence of having been hot and molten during emplacement, volcanic bombs).
